How We Calculate Calories Burned for Power Walking in Wilmington
Our calculator uses the standard MET (Metabolic Equivalent of Task) formula with a local climate adjustment for Wilmington:
Calories = MET ×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× Climate Factor
= 5 ×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× 1.03
The MET value of 5 for power walking is sourced from the Compendium of Physical Activities. The climate factor of 1.03 accounts for Wilmington's average temperature of 52°F. Research shows that exercising in non-neutral temperatures increases energy expenditure as the body works to maintain its core temperature.
Power walking is a fitness-focused walking technique performed at speeds of 4.5-5.5 mph, just below the threshold where running begins. It involves an exaggerated arm swing, a heel-to-toe foot strike, and maintaining at least one foot on the ground at all times. Power walking burns nearly as many calories as jogging at the same speed but with significantly less joint impact. Competitive race walkers can walk a mile in under 7 minutes, demonstrating the high intensity this activity can achieve.
